Sir Paul McCartney is set to make a cameo appearance in Pirates of the Caribbean 5: Dead Men Tell No Tales. Along with Johnny Depp, who will reprise his much-loved role as Captain Jack Sparrow, the Beatles star will appear in the latest sequel.

The Independent has reported that McCartney is due to play an integral part to a new set piece being added to the film, which has already finished shooting.

McCartney will be surrounded by returning cast members including Orlando Bloom and Geoffrey Rush and new additions including Javier Bardem who will take over the reins as this film’s villain.

Depp has suggested that this will "probably" be the last film and Disney appears to be determined to send it out in style, spending over $250million on this fifth chapter.

Directed by Norwegian duo Joachim Rønning and Espen Sandberg, it has been previously reported that Depp’s role has been made smaller to increase film time for Bardem, known for his ability to play the bad guy well - having also done so opposite James Bond in Skyfall.

McCartney is the second big musician coup for Pirates after rock star Keith Richards took on the role of Jack Sparrow’s father in Pirates of the Caribbean: At World’s End in 2007.

Pirates of the Caribbean: Dead Men Tell No Tales is due out in 2017.
